The Provincial Government of Misamis Occidental is actively seeking the cooperation of landowners to advance the long-planned expansion of Ozamiz City Airport, a critical infrastructure project that promises to boost connectivity, tourism, and economic growth in the province.
A Key Infrastructure Priority
Ozamiz City Airport, also known as Labo Airport, serves as the primary air gateway to Misamis Occidental and neighboring provinces in Northern Mindanao. The airport expansion project has been identified as a priority under the provincial development roadmap, as it is expected to accommodate larger aircraft, increase flight frequency, and open new routes to major Philippine cities.
Provincial officials have been engaging with landowners whose properties are within the proposed expansion area. The cooperation of these landowners is essential for the acquisition of additional land needed for runway extension, terminal upgrades, and improved support facilities.
Economic Impact and Tourism Potential
The expansion of Ozamiz Airport is seen as a game-changer for the local economy. Improved air connectivity would make it easier for tourists to visit Misamis Occidental popular attractions, including the historic Immaculate Conception Pipe Organ in the Ozamiz Cathedral, the scenic Mount Malindang Range Natural Park, and the beautiful coastal areas along Panguil Bay.
Business leaders in Ozamiz City have expressed strong support for the project, noting that better air transport links would attract investments, facilitate trade, and create jobs in the hospitality, retail, and logistics sectors.
Partnerships and Funding
The provincial government is exploring partnerships with national agencies, including the Department of Transportation (DOTr) and the Civil Aviation Authority of the Philippines (CAAP), to secure funding and technical support for the airport expansion. Discussions with potential private sector partners are also underway to explore public-private partnership arrangements.
Local officials remain optimistic that with the cooperation of landowners and support from national government agencies, the Ozamiz Airport expansion can move forward in the near term.
